I picked up a single leaning post pretty cheap on CL last weekend. I had to cut the mounting plate and redrill it to get the proper distance from the steering wheel and installed it. Test ran it today in choppy conditions and it was great. High enough to lean against and low enough to sit on. Much more comfortable than the original seat and it gives me a backrest for the livewell seat. I just need to clean it up and and it will be looking like new.
